Onrif
About Onrif Products
Onrif Products side effects
Common
Side Effects of Onrif are Fatigue, Headache, Constipation, Diarrhea, Hypoxia (decreased oxygen level in blood).
How Onrif Products work
Ondansetron is an antiemetic medication. It works by blocking the action of a chemical messenger (serotonin) in the brain that may cause nausea and vomiting during anti-cancer treatment (chemotherapy) or after surgery.

Frequently asked questions about Ondansetron
Q. How quickly does Onrif 2mg Oral Drops work?
Onrif 2mg Oral Drops starts working within half an hour to 2 hours. It dissolves rapidly into the bloodstream and starts showing its effect.
Q. What are the side effects of Onrif 2mg Oral Drops?
The most common side effects of Onrif 2mg Oral Drops are constipation, diarrhea, fatigue and headache. However, these are usually not bothersome and resolve on their own after some time. Consult your doctor if these persist or worry you.
Q. When should you take Onrif 2mg Oral Drops?
Onrif 2mg Oral Drops should be taken with a full glass of water, with or without food. It should be used exactly as per the dose and duration advised by the doctor. Usually, the first dose of Onrif 2mg Oral Drops is taken before the start of your surgery, chemotherapy or radiation treatment.
Q. Is Onrif 2mg Oral Drops a steroid?
No, Onrif 2mg Oral Drops is an antiemetic and not a steroid. Onrif 2mg Oral Drops is a selective 5-HT3 receptor antagonist. It is prescribed for the prevention and treatment of nausea and vomiting which is commonly observed after surgery or due to cancer chemotherapy.
Q. Does Onrif 2mg Oral Drops work for seasickness?
No, Onrif 2mg Oral Drops does not work for seasickness. This is because Onrif 2mg Oral Drops has very little effect on the nausea associated with motion sickness.
